Psalm 127.2: This Blogger Needs Your Prayer Please.
The verse suggests that insomnia can stem from trying to work in one's own strength, and it serves as a spiritual reminder to trust God, acknowledge his provision, and not rely on tireless, worried effort for the results of the labour, which are ultimately from Him.
